PMC-Sierra Cuts Q3 Business Outlook

PMC-Sierra announced new financial guidance, saying it now expects Q3 revenue to be $71 million to $73 million compared with reported second quarter revenues of $85.7 million. The company's previous outlook was for Q3 revenues to be in the range of $86 million to $92 million, or flat to up 7%.



PMC-Sierra said the cut in Q3 revenue outlook was "primarily attributable to changes in customer demand and inventory levels associated with recent reductions in the planned deployment rates of DSL equipment by Asian service providers for the second half of 2004. Also, generally improved availability of semiconductor components is causing a reduction in semiconductor orders below the consumption rates available in end markets served.
